Synergistic Roles of Bone Morphogenetic Protein 15 and Growth Differentiation Factor 9 in Ovarian Function
2001-06-01
Abstract excerpt
Knockout mouse technology has been used over the last decade to define the essential roles of ovarian-expressed genes and uncover genetic interactions. In particular, we have used this technology to study the function of multiple members of the transforming growth factor-β superfamily including inhibins, activins, and growth differentiation factor 9 (GDF-9 or Gdf9).
